front cover of Calculating Brilliance
Calculating Brilliance
An Intellectual History of Mayan Astronomy at Chich’en Itza
Gerardo Aldana y Villalobos
University of Arizona Press, 2021
To the modern eye, the architects at Chich’en Itza produced some of the most mysterious structures in ancient Mesoamerica. The purpose and cultural influences behind this architecture seem left to conjecture. The people who created and lived around this stunning site may seem even more mercurial.

Near the structure known today as the Great Ball Court and within the interior of the Lower Temple of the Jaguar, a mural depicts a female Mayan astronomer called K'uk'ul Ek' Tuyilaj. Weaving together archaeology, mathematics, history, and astronomy, Calculating Brilliance brings to light the discovery by this Mayan astronomer, which is recorded in the Venus Table of the Dresden Codex. As the book demonstrates, this brilliant discovery reverberated throughout Mayan science. But it has remained obscured to modern eyes.

Jumping from the vital contributions of K'uk'ul Ek' Tuyilaj, Gerardo Aldana y Villalobos critically reframes science in the pre-Columbian world. He reexamines the historiography of the Dresden Codex and contextualizes the Venus Table relative to other Indigenous literature. From a perspective anchored to Indigenous cosmologies and religions, Aldana y Villalobos delves into how we may understand Indigenous science and discovery—both its parallels and divergences from modern globalized perspectives of science.

Calculating Brilliance brings different intellectual threads together across time and space, from the Classic to the Postclassic, the colonial period to the twenty-first century to offer a new vision for understanding Mayan astronomy.

front cover of Cycles of the Sun, Mysteries of the Moon
Cycles of the Sun, Mysteries of the Moon
The Calendar in Mesoamerican Civilization
By Vincent H. Malmström
University of Texas Press, 1996

The simple question "How did the Maya come up with a calendar that had only 260 days?" led Vincent Malmström to discover an unexpected "hearth" of Mesoamerican culture. In this boldly revisionist book, he sets forth his challenging, new view of the origin and diffusion of Mesoamerican calendrical systems—the intellectual achievement that gave rise to Mesoamerican civilization and culture.

Malmström posits that the 260-day calendar marked the interval between passages of the sun at its zenith over Izapa, an ancient ceremonial center in the Soconusco region of Mexico's Pacific coastal plain. He goes on to show how the calendar developed by the Zoque people of the region in the fourteenth century B.C. gradually diffused through Mesoamerica into the so-called "Olmec metropolitan area" of the Gulf coast and beyond to the Maya in the east and to the plateau of Mexico in the west.

These findings challenge our previous understanding of the origin and diffusion of Mesoamerican civilization. Sure to provoke lively debate in many quarters, this book will be important reading for all students of ancient Mesoamerica—anthropologists, archaeologists, archaeoastronomers, geographers, and the growing public fascinated by all things Maya.

front cover of Códice Maya de México
Códice Maya de México
Understanding the Oldest Surviving Book of the Americas
Andrew D. Turner
J. Paul Getty Trust, The, 2022
An in-depth exploration of the history, authentication, and modern relevance of Códice Maya de México, the oldest surviving book of the Americas.
 
Ancient Maya scribes recorded prophecies and astronomical observations on the pages of painted books. Although most were lost to decay or destruction, three pre-Hispanic Maya codices were known to have survived, when, in the 1960s, a fourth book that differed from the others appeared in Mexico under mysterious circumstances. After fifty years of debate over its authenticity, recent investigations using cutting-edge scientific and art historical analyses determined that Códice Maya de México (formerly known as Grolier Codex) is in fact the oldest surviving book of the Americas, predating all others by at least two hundred years.
 
This volume provides a multifaceted introduction to the creation, discovery, interpretation, and scientific authentication of Códice Maya de México. In addition, a full-color facsimile and a page-by-page guide to the iconography make the codex accessible to a wide audience. Additional topics include the uses and importance of sacred books in Mesoamerica, the role of astronomy in ancient Maya societies, and the codex's continued relevance to contemporary Maya communities.

front cover of Star Gods of the Maya
Star Gods of the Maya
Astronomy in Art, Folklore, and Calendars
By Susan Milbrath
University of Texas Press, 2000

Observations of the sun, moon, planets, and stars played a central role in ancient Maya lifeways, as they do today among contemporary Maya who maintain the traditional ways. This pathfinding book reconstructs ancient Maya astronomy and cosmology through the astronomical information encoded in Precolumbian Maya art and confirmed by the current practices of living Maya peoples.

Susan Milbrath opens the book with a discussion of modern Maya beliefs about astronomy, along with essential information on naked-eye observation. She devotes subsequent chapters to Precolumbian astronomical imagery, which she traces back through time, starting from the Colonial and Postclassic eras. She delves into many aspects of the Maya astronomical images, including the major astronomical gods and their associated glyphs, astronomical almanacs in the Maya codices [painted books], and changes in the imagery of the heavens over time. This investigation yields new data and a new synthesis of information about the specific astronomical events and cycles recorded in Maya art and architecture. Indeed, it constitutes the first major study of the relationship between art and astronomy in ancient Maya culture.
